> > Because we use av_assert0() instead of assert() everywhere. Apparently
> > the latter is normally disabled. The code wasn't even valid and never
> > actually compiled, and I never noticed it myself. (michaelni didn't
> > notice this either, so this patch broke compilation. It was fixed with
> > patch 2/11, which I kept separate for authorship information.)
> 
> Actually we should use the normal assert and have a fate instance to
> enable them.

We have such a FATE instance.  It does not, however, enabled all (or any
really) external libraries.
